What makes a battery pack Safe?

The design for the safety of the whole pack is an integration of all the subsystems into one single unit. Mechanical design, high- and low-voltage electrical design, sensors, pumps, valves, and all the elements of thermal management together, form the basis of the whole battery pack design and development.

How important is a battery pack?

The first safety consideration is structural integrity, as the whole pack constitutes a significant mass. The strength and stiffness are unquestionably important as the mass influences the way the battery pack structurally behaves, both separate from the vehicle and when installed in the vehicle.

What are the dangers of a battery pack?

The hardest and most hidden threat of the battery pack is fire. No manufacturer or EV driver would ever think about their battery energy storage systems catching fire. This type of catastrophe may sometimes arise from sparking or burning due to the manufacturing defects such as internal short circuits.
